On the 7th, Haman-gun, Gyeongnam held the first review meeting of the 'Hometown Love Fund Management Deliberation Committee.'


The county's 'Hometown Love Fund Management Deliberation Committee' is composed of experts related to funds such as accounting and taxation, and plays a role as a planner and evaluator of fund utilization projects for transparent and efficient management of the income from hometown love donations.

At the first meeting held along with the appointment ceremony, the agenda titled 'Haman-gun Hometown Love Fund Establishment and Operation Plan' was submitted and approved as originally proposed.


The county currently offers return gifts such as processed foods and crafts made from agricultural products produced within the county, as well as experiential return gifts that allow people to enjoy the beautiful nature of Haman.



Meanwhile, the Hometown Love Donation System is a system that allows individuals to donate up to 5 million KRW annually to local governments other than their registered address. Donors receive a full tax deduction up to 100,000 KRW, and a 16.5% tax credit on the excess amount, and up to 30% of the donation amount is provided as return gifts from the recipient local government.
